The Bank of Japan (BoJ) has approved a massive multi-asset purchase programme, including the purchase of billions of dollars worth of exchange-traded funds (ETFs), designed to stimulate the Japanese economy. The BoJ will purchase Topix and Nikkei 225 ETFs so that the amount outstanding will increase at an annual pace of 1 trillion yen – approximately $10.5 billion per year.

Contrary to recent forecasts predicting the end of the gold bull market, Graham Tuckwell, Founder and Chairman of ETF Securities, believes untapped demand from China and India, and retail investors, will lead to a second decade of growth for the gold market. Ten years on since Tuckwell launched the world’s first physical gold exchange-traded product in Australia, similar products are now listed on 31 exchanges throughout the world and have seen assets under management reach $147 billion.

Global index provider FTSE Group and DPT Capital Management, a New Jersey-based investment firm, have announced the launch of the FTSE Target Exposure Commodity Index Series, a series of rules-based long-short commodity indices. The indices are derived from the innovative work of Professor John M. Mulvey, a Princeton University academic and co-founder of DPT Capital, on risk management and portfolio allocation, an approach known as Dynamic Portfolio Tactics.

Lyxor has announced the launch of the Lyxor ETF MSCI ACWI Gold (GLDM), a new exchange-traded fund offering access to a global portfolio of gold mining stocks. The fund, which is based on the MSCI ACWI Gold Index, enables investors to gain exposure to the gold theme via mining companies whose fortunes are strongly tied to the price of the precious metal. The fund has been listed on the NYSE Euronext Paris and comes with a management fee of 0.50%.

Commodity ETP assets rose to a year-end record high of $199.8 billion in 2012, an increase of $29 billion compared to the end of 2011. Commodity ETP assets have nearly doubled since the end of 2009 and have increased nearly seven-fold over the past five years as investor demand for hard assets (particularly gold and silver) and familiarity with commodity exchange-traded products have increased.

Japanese equities have rallied strongly over the past three months, with the widely followed Nikkei 225 adding an impressive 20.6%. However, Japan-linked equity ETFs haven’t necessarily matched this stellar performance. The NYSE-listed iShares MSCI Japan ETF (EWJ), for example, managed only 7.5%. By contrast, dollar-hedged ETFs, which hedge currency fluctuations between the dollar and yen, have kept in sync. The WisdomTree Japan Hedged Equity ETF (DXJ), for example, posted a return of 19.5%.

Stoxx, a leading index provider, has announced the launch of the iSTOXX Efficient Capital Managed Futures 20 Index, a new index based on research provided by Efficient Capital Management, a global leader in the Managed Futures industry. The index, which measures the performance of some of the world’s largest Commodity Trading Advisors (CTAs), has potential uses as a benchmark against a single CTA or pool of CTAs, or as an underlying for financial products such as synthetic exchange-traded funds.
